The Orange County Hispanic Chamber of Commerce, in collaboration with the Small Business Administration (SBA), Internal Revenue Service (IRS), Orange County Board of Equalization (BOE), consulates of Mexico, El Salvador and Colombia, and various private enterprises engaged with the proper development of Hispanic businesses in Southern California invite you to attend the Latino Business Entrepreneurs Conference on January 29, 2011 from 8:00 am through 3 pm.  The conference will be held at the Santa Ana Elks Lodge, located at 212 Elks Lane, in Santa Ana.

Registration is $15 if you pre-order, or $20 at the door.  Be advised that this conference will be offered in Spanish only.
